Research the explosive train detonation time of the electronic time fuze for the underwater pressure device

Abstract

In this paper, using numerical simulation combined with experiment, the detonation time of the explosive train of the electronic time fuze from the signal source to the fuze booster has been determined. The results show that the influence of the transmission line and the connector on the detonation train time is very small, this influence in the design can be ignored. The results after the study are proven experimentally and the experimental results show that the simulation results are reliable and highly applicable. The results of the article are applied to manufacturing and testing electronic time fuze use for the underwater pressure device.
